Milan Masonic Lodge No. 31 is a historic Masonic lodge located at Milan, Ripley County, Indiana. It was built in 1937, and is a two-story, brick building with modest Romanesque Revival and Queen Anne style design elements. It features elliptical and round-arched openings, a steeply pitched gable roof, pyramidal tower, stained glass windows, and wood detailing in the gable ends. It is the oldest continuously active Masonic Lodges in Ripley County.

It was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 2013.
